About Alaskan Sights & Bites

Alaskan Sights & Bites operates guided tours based in Anchorage, Alaska, specializing in culinary experiences, wildlife conservation visits, and glacier excursions. The company curates a range of half-day and multi-hour tours that highlight Southcentral Alaska’s landscapes, food culture, and natural history. Tours include visits to the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center, food-focused walking tours in downtown Anchorage and Spenard, a city van tour with local insights, chocolate and wine tastings, and guided treks on Matanuska Glacier.

Guides provide interpretive narration, regional context, and local recommendations while transporting guests along established routes such as the Seward Highway and into Girdwood. Food and beverage experiences showcase Alaskan ingredients — from fresh seafood to local craft beer, wines, and artisan chocolates. The Matanuska Glacier trek includes expert-led ice travel and a lodge lunch, with small-group options for personalized attention.

Tours emphasize education and thoughtful engagement with Alaska’s wildlife and communities. Visits to the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center focus on conservation and observation of native species in a managed, educational setting. Culinary tours combine regional storytelling with curated tastings at established local partners. Based in Anchorage, the company positions tours to provide straightforward access to both urban highlights and nearby natural attractions. Alaskan Sights & Bites presents experiences designed for visitors who want guided, factual interpretation of Alaska’s foodways, wildlife, and glaciers.

Popular Tour Types

  • Wildlife Conservation Center W/ Lunch & Beer Sampling — Scenic drive along the Seward Highway to the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center in Girdwood, with interpretive wildlife viewing plus local lunch and craft beer tastings.
  • City of Anchorage Food & Sightseeing Van Tour — Half-day van tour showcasing Anchorage neighborhoods, mountain views, and Alaskan culinary stops from fresh seafood to craft beer.
  • Downtown Anchorage Walking Food Tour — Three-hour walking tour through downtown Anchorage combining local history, cultural storytelling, and curated tastings.
  • Chocolate & Wine Tour — Small-group tasting featuring artisan chocolates from Chugach Chocolates and wines at 61 Degree North Winery.
  • Spenard Food & True Crime Walking Tour — A themed tour exploring the Spenard neighborhood’s history, food stops, and true-crime storytelling from the 1970s.
  • Matanuska Glacier — Guided two-hour glacier trek on Matanuska Glacier with expert instruction, scenic viewpoints, and a lodge lunch.
